At Oracle OpenWorld in San Francisco, HP chief executive Mark Hurd joins Oracle chief executive Larry Ellison via videoconference to show a new hardware solution developed by the two companies.
The HP Oracle Database Machine is preconfigured and certified to run Oracle's business-intelligence apps and real application clusters. HP will provide hardware support and the machines will be ordered from Oracle.
